Vivo Launches X9, X9 Plus, and Xplay6 in China
Daphne Planca | | Nov 20, 2016 10:55 PM EST |
(Photo : YouTube Screenshot) The Vivo X9, Vivo X9 Plus, and Vivo Xplay6 smartphones are officially available in the Chinese market.
Chinese smartphone maker Vivo officially launched its latest devices - the Vivo X9, Vivo X9 Plus, and Vivo Xplay6 smartphones - in China. The 64GB model of the Vivo X9 is currently priced at 2,798 CNY ($405.78), while the 128GB model cost at around 2,998 CNY ($434.79). The Vivo Xplay6 is priced at 4,498 CNY ($652.21); however, no information yet on the price tag for the X9 Plus.

The Vivo X9 smartphone features a 5.5-inch Full HD (1920 x 1080 pixels) display screen. The device is powered by an octa-core Snapdragon 625 processor, which is paired with 4GB of RAM onboard. It is available in two variant storages - the 64GB and 128GB models. On the camera, the phone sports a16-megapixel rear shooter and 20-megapixel + 8-megapixel dual front cameras. It runs on Android 6.0 (Marshmallow) operating system out of the box, coupled with FuntouchOS 3.0 user interface laid on top and backed with a 3,050mAh capacity battery.
The Vivo X9 Plus smartphone features a 5.88-inch Full HD (1920 x 1080 pixels) display screen. The device is powered by an octa-core Snapdragon 653, coupled with a massive 6GB of RAM onboard. It comes equipped with a built-in 128GB native internal storage. On the camera, the phone sports a16-megapixel rear shooter and 20-megapixel + 8-megapixel dual front cameras. The handset runs on Android 6.0 (Marshmallow) operating system out of the box, along with FuntouchOS 3.0 user interface laid on top. It is backed with a huge 4,000mAh capacity battery.
Lastly, the Vivo Xplay 6 smartphone features a 5.46-inch Quad HD (2560 x 1440) Super AMOLED display screen. The device is powered by a quad-core Snapdragon, 6GB of RAM, and a built-in 128GB of internal memory storage. On the camera, the phone sports a 12-megapixel rear shooter and a 5-megapixel front camera. The handset runs on Android 6.0 (Marshmallow) operating system with FuntouchOS 3.0 user interface laid on top of it. It is backed with a huge 4,080mAh capacity battery.
